    Sometimes, it does happen. Not only for Wilders Security Forum, though.

    When it happens try re-enter the domain in the address bar. I think that adding -www.wilderssecurity.com to hosts file with the respective IP would prevent further problems.

    For whatever reason ClearCloud fails to resolve -www.wilderssecurity.com, and displays the message.
